Charity Information
Protection of Northumberland's rivers and streams - those flowing into the North Sea south of the Tweed and north of the Tyne. We work with communities, anglers and partner organisations to reduce the sediment getting into rivers, improve the passage of fish and eels, improve habitat, and share knowledge and understanding of our waterways and coast.
